Without a Trace, the riveting police procedural and investigative drama about an FBI team that searches for missing people, debuted in 2002, continuing CSI executive producer Jerry Bruckheimer's impressive streak of hot TV dramas. Series star Anthony LaPaglia stars as senior agent Jack Malone, head of the FBI's Missing Persons Squad, a special task force that combines profiling and psychology with traditional investigative techniques. Malone's team includes agents Samantha Spade (Poppy Montgomery), Vivian Johnson (Marianne Jean-Baptiste), Danny Taylor (Enrique Murciano), and rookie Martin Fitzgerald (Eric Close). Each brings unique strengths to the unit -- such as Johnson's knack for dealing with the families of the missing -- and their goal is achieve a result within 48 hours; any longer than that, Malone explains, and the person is unlikely to be found. The absorbing part of the show lies in following the team members in their investigations, from talking to family members to delving into the most personal aspects of the missing person's life. The series' pilot offers up tantalizing clues surrounding a missing marketing executive as the team re-creates the woman's previous 24 hours, which included contact with two lovers, job tension, and a cocaine purchase. Other fascinating investigations in this first season include the searches for: an 11-year-old who disappears on an outing to Yankee Stadium in "Birthday Boy"; a businessman whose double life is revealed after he goes missing before an airline flight home in "Silent Partner"; and a pregnant woman who disappears in "Underground Railroad." Amber Tamblyn makes a noteworthy pre-Joan of Arcadia appearance in "Clare de Lune," about a teen who vanishes from a mental hospital while suffering from psychosis. When the team finally discovers what happened to each person after an episode-long investigation, it's as satisfying for the viewers as it is for the agents. Christina Urban, Barnes & Noble
